The anthems had some interesting history behind them that I talked about in World History earlier: basically, the South Vietnamese anthem was composed by a Viet Cong, and the North Vietnamese anthem was composed by a guy whose songs were later banned by Ho Chi Minh.

You gotta remember that since the USSR and to present times Russia's official doctrine is multinationalism, multiconfessionalism, multiculturalism and all that. So an anthem that has so much distinctively Rus' spirit about it just wouldn't fit, 'cause it would supposedly upset poor muslims and other minorities :rolleyes:

So another one was choosen, decent too, but not too energetic.


Link to video.



It wasn't officially established by appropriate legal procedure until 2000, when the revamped Soviet one was reinstated.
